** The walk-in tub market in Lawrenceville and the broader Gwinnett County area is robust and competitive, driven by a growing senior population seeking to age in place safely. The average quality of providers is high, with several established local contractors and national franchises competing on service, product quality, and warranty. * **Competition Level:** Moderate to High. Homeowners have multiple reputable options, ranging from specialized local remodelers to large national brands, ensuring a good balance of choice and competitive pricing. * **Typical Pricing:** Walk-in tub projects are significant investments. A basic tub installation can start from **$3,000 to $5,000**, but a full, high-end accessible bathroom remodel with a premium hydrotherapy tub, new fixtures, and safety features typically ranges from **$10,000 to $20,000+**. Pricing is heavily influenced by the tub model (acrylic vs. cast iron, basic vs. hydrotherapy), the complexity of the installation (plumbing/electrical modifications), and the extent of accompanying tile work and accessibility features. * **Key Differentiators:** The top providers distinguish themselves through in-home consultation services, strong warranties on both labor and product, proven expertise in navigating the specific challenges of bathroom accessibility, and partnerships with reputable tub manufacturers.

In Lawrenceville, a complete walk-in tub installation typ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000+, depending on the tub model, features, and the complexity of your bathroom's plumbing and electrical work. Local factors include Georgia's sales tax, potential costs for bringing older homes up to current Gwinnett County plumbing codes, and the need for reinforced flooring which is common in local construction. It's crucial to get itemized quotes from local providers to understand all potential costs.
A professional installation by a Lawrenceville-based service typically takes 1 to 3 days, from removal of the old fixture to full completion. Considering Georgia's climate, scheduling during milder seasons like spring or fall is often more comfortable, as it minimizes the time your home is open to extreme summer heat or humidity during the installation process. This also helps avoid potential delays from peak contractor demand in summer.
Yes, most walk-in tub installations in Lawrenceville require a plumbing permit from the Gwinnett County Department of Planning and Development, and often an electrical permit if new wiring or a dedicated circuit is needed for jet pumps or heaters. Reputable local installers will typically handle this permitting process for you, ensuring the work complies with Georgia's Uniform Construction Codes and local amendments, which is crucial for both safety and home resale value.

This is a valid concern. Modern walk-in tubs are designed with efficiency in mind, featuring quicker fill times and lower water capacity soaking options. Many Lawrenceville homeowners opt for air-jet systems instead of water-jet whirlpools to reduce fill volume. Considering Gwinnett County's water rates and the state's occasional drought advisories, discussing water-efficient models with your local installer is wise. They can recommend the best options to balance therapeutic benefits with responsible water use.
